Macaulay Culkin, one of the most famous American child stars, was born on August 26, 1980 in New York City, New York, USA, as the third of seven children of his father Kit Culkin (a former stage and child actor and also Macaulay's former manager) and mother Patricia Brentrup. He is the brother of Shane Culkin, Dakota Culkin, Kieran Culkin, Quinn Culkin, Christian Culkin, and Rory Culkin, most of whom have also acted. Macaulay's mother, who is from North Dakota, is of German and Norwegian descent. Macaulay's father, from Manhattan, has Irish, German, English, Swiss-German, and French ancestry."Mack", as he's known to his close friends and family, first came into showbiz at the age of 4, appearing in a string of Off-Broadway shows such as the New York City Ballet's The Nutcracker and, by 8 years-old, the films Rocket Gibraltar (1988) and See You in the Morning (1989), which included him in the rare company of kids who have received rave reviews from The New Yorker and The New York Times.By the age of 9, the young actor had nearly upstaged star John Candy in Uncle Buck (1989) (his deadpan interrogation of Candy was Buck's funniest scene). Then, in 1990, writer John Hughes turned his finished Home Alone (1990) script over to director Chris Columbus with a suggestion to consider Culkin for the lead. Though Macaulay was the first kid Columbus saw, he was skeptical about having him in the lead and saw over 200 other possible actors and he admitted that no one came as close to being as good as Culkin. By the callback interview, Mack had memorized two scenes, and Columbus was sure he found his "Kevin McCallister". The movie grossed more than $285 million in the US alone, becoming one of the highest grossing movies of all time and making Macaulay Culkin one of the biggest movie stars of the time.His next big project was My Girl (1991) in which he played "Thomas J. Sennett", a boy who seems to be allergic to everything. Despite some controversy over the ending, the film was released anyway and proved to be another hit film for Mack (and featured his very first kiss). In 1992 came Home Alone 2: Lost in New York (1992), which grossed more than $172 million in the US alone. In 1993 came The Good Son (1993), which was the first role to depart from his cute kid comedies. He played a murderous little demon named Henry. He got the role when his powerhouse negotiator/manager/father Kit Culkin said that he would pull Mack out of Home Alone 2: Lost in New York (1992) unless he was given the psychotic boy lead in The Good Son (1993). He was also given a salary of $5 million for the film.In 1994, at the age of 14, came a string of duds, The Pagemaster (1994), Getting Even with Dad (1994) and Richie Rich (1994). He was paid $8 million for the last two, the highest salary ever paid for a child star. Many people believed Mack had lost his touch, though, because he was no longer that cute tiny kid they saw in Home Alone (1990). In 1995 his parents, who were never married, separated and started a greedy legal battle over the custody of their kids and Mack's fortune. In 1996, the young actor had reportedly said he wouldn't accept any roles until his parents settled their custody dispute. That case would not be resolved until April 1997 when Kit Culkin relinquished control to Brentrup.In 1998, Macaulay married actress Rachel Miner, but separated in 2000 because Rachel wanted to start a family and Mack wanted to get back into acting. There has been a gap of eight years since 1994's Richie Rich (1994), and although he made a 'comeback' on stage in 2001, appearing in a London production of "Madame Melville", and also portrayed Michael Alig in Party Monster (2003); with an estimated fortune of $17 million he clearly never has to work again - if the roles don't appeal to him.

Tivia: Was in a relationship with Mila Kunis from 2002 until late 2010.Became the first child actor to ever receive $1 million for one film - and in a supporting role too! The film was My Girl (1991).His 29-year-old sister, Dakota Culkin, passed away after accidentally being struck by a car on 10 December 2008 in Los Angeles, California.Besides being godfather to Michael Jackson's first child Prince Michael Jackson, Macaulay is also godfather to Jackson's daughter Paris Jackson.He has a half-sister, Jennifer Adamson, from another relationship of his father. Jennifer died in 2000 at age 29 from a drug overdose.His brother Kieran Culkin played his cousin in Home Alone (1990) and Home Alone 2: Lost in New York (1992).His brother Rory Culkin, now an established actor in his own right, has played both Macaulay's little brother (in The Good Son (1993) and the younger version of Macaulay's character (in Richie Rich (1994)).Has a scar on his finger that occurred during the filming of "Home Alone" when Joe Pesci bit his finger.Bought Marilyn Manson his first pack of cigarettes for Manson's role as Christina during the filming of Party Monster (2003). He said he found it so ironic considering that Manson is considered "the Antichrist" by many, and it's Macaulay Culkin who's corrupting him.His performance as Kevin McCallister in Home Alone (1990) is ranked #99 on Premiere Magazine's 100 Greatest Movie Characters of All Time.Dropped out of his senior year at the Professional Children's School (a high school), the school where he met his ex-wife, Rachel Miner.Has a son, Dakota Song Culkin (b. April 5, 2021) with his girlfriend, Brenda Song.Burned out at age 14, he quit acting in 1995 and only recently made a 'comeback' on stage in 2001, appearing in a London production of "Madame Melville," playing a 15-year-old who is seduced by his French teacher. It later moved off-Broadway for a four-month stint.Was a close friend of Uncle Buck (1989) and Home Alone (1990) co-star John Candy. Prior to Candy's death in March of 1994, the two were reportedly in talks of doing a third movie together.The role of Kevin McCallister in Home Alone (1990) was written for Macaulay by John Hughes (who had written and directed another film which featured Macaulay, Uncle Buck (1989)). Despite this, some other boys were auditioned by Chris Columbus just to make sure that Macaulay was right.Brother of Shane Culkin (b. 1976), Dakota Culkin (1978-2008), Kieran Culkin (b. 1982), Quinn Culkin (b. 1984), Christian Culkin (b. 1987), and Rory Culkin (b. 1989).Got married to Rachel Miner shortly before his 18th birthday. In the United States, marriage before the age of 18 is legal only with parental permission.Has been living in Paris, France, since 2013.Macaulay was named after Thomas Babington Macaulay, and his middle name Carson for Kit Carson of the old west.After securing Culkin, Joe Pesci, and Daniel Stern for Home Alone (1990), Chris Columbus felt confident enough to cast actors who were his heroes growing up like Catherine O'Hara after seeing her work on SCTV (1976), as well as John Heard and then Tim Curry and Rob Schneider on Home Alone 2: Lost in New York (1992), because they were all open to the films.Ranked #2 on the VH1 list of 100 Greatest Kid Stars (2012).Studied at the School of American Ballet. The school is the official training academy of the New York City Ballet. Its founders (in 1934) were Lincoln Kirstein and George Balanchine.Wrote a book titled "Junior".Stage debut at age of four in "Bach Babies".Nephew of Bonnie Bedelia.When casting the role of Kevin McCallister for Home Alone (1990), Chris Columbus had already seen him in Uncle Buck (1989) but he wanted to audition some other kids first while writer and producer John Hughes had his heart set on Culkin. So Columbus met Culkin in New York and was very charmed by him and thought he was fantastic. Columbus auditioned five other kids and none of them shaped up to Culkin. Columbus went with Culkin because he was not as picture perfect and he had an instant relatability to the kids in the audience. Columbus knew the cameras would love him and he was immensely funny.Son of Kit Culkin and Patricia Brentrup. His parents were together for 21 years from 1974-1995, but never married.Had a small part in the Oliver Stone movie Born on the Fourth of July (1989), but his scenes were cut.On the set of Home Alone (1990), Culkin would jokingly direct the film for Chris Columbus.Is a big fan of the popular RPG game "World of Warcraft".Reports claim the Culkin family could soon be homeless. Control of Macaulay's finances have been removed from the family and placed in the hands of his accountant. (February 1997)[17 September 2004] Arrested for marijuana possession in Oklahoma.Was ranked #2 in E's Most Cutest Child Stars All Grown-Up (2005).Father hands sole custody of Macaulay and his siblings over to their mother. Parents never married and mother filed for custody. (April 1997)Ranked #2 in VH1's list of the "100 Greatest Kid Stars".He and his wife buy a $1.7 million, 5200-foot loft on lower Broadway in Manhattan. (November 1999)Is a fan of professional wrestling.Childhood friend of Laura Bell Bundy; her mother was the Culkin family babysitter.Was considered for the role of "Mark Sway" in The Client (1994) but lost out to Brad Renfro.His father is of one-quarter Irish and of German, English, Swiss-German, and French descent. His mother is of half-German and half-Norwegian ancestry.Filming a new movie with Jena Malone and Eva Amurri. (2002)Born on the same date as Chris Pine.Attended WWF's (now WWE) WrestleMania VII (1991) on March 24, 1991.Best known for his role as Kevin McCallister in Home Alone (1990) and Home Alone 2: Lost in New York (1992).He was in three movies with John Candy: Uncle Buck (1989), Home Alone (1990), and Only the Lonely (1991); In the latter, they had no screen time together and Culkin had only a cameo appearance.
